You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

SQLServer:在缺失月份的表格中插入默认值

可以使用一个表格或表格变量来存储所有可能会出现的月份,然后使用LEFT JOIN将其连接到需要插入默认值的表格上。在连接后使用COALESCE函数将NULL值替换为默认值,最后将结果插入到表格中。

示例代码:

-- 创建包含所有月份的表格变量 DECLARE @Months Table (MonthDate Date) DECLARE @StartDate Date = '20200101' DECLARE @EndDate Date = '20201201'

WHILE @StartDate < @EndDate BEGIN INSERT INTO @Months (MonthDate) VALUES (@StartDate) SET @StartDate = DATEADD(MONTH, 1, @StartDate) END

-- 连接并插入默认值 INSERT INTO [TableName] (MonthDate, Column1, Column2, Column3) SELECT m.MonthDate, COALESCE(t.Column1, DefaultValue1), COALESCE(t.Column2, DefaultValue2), COALESCE(t.Column3, DefaultValue3) FROM @Months m LEFT JOIN [TableName] t ON t.MonthDate = m.MonthDate CROSS JOIN (SELECT DefaultValue1, DefaultValue2, DefaultValue3 FROM [DefaultsTable]) d

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

【模板推荐】玩转SQL Server数据库自动同步

用户可以在“模板中心”搜索应用名称,选择适合自己的场景,直接使用。本期分享 **SQL Server**自动化工作流程。![picture.image](https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/6fa94d6... 免费入驻集简云应用中心,让您的产品拥有与800+款软件连接的能力![点击添加负责人信息](https://work.weixin.qq.com/ca/cawcde884ca3f5cfea),帮助您快速上架![![picture.image](https://p6-volc-c...

【模板推荐】玩转SQL Server数据库自动同步

[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/baec24fd122d457697fd1f68b48721fa~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1716135627&x-signature=FQomYph%2FPlBBgxmw1MyfXat1dtM%3D)集简云平台内置大量自动化流程模板,用户可以在“模板中心”搜索应用名称,选择适合自己的场景,直接使用。本期分享 **SQL Server**自动化工作流程。![picture.image](https:...

Microsoft SQL Server 从零开始成为高手,全攻略

如何才能成为某一个领域的高手?你需要有一个明确的目标(知道要学什么);同时还要为这个目标找到一条明确的道路(知道怎么学)。最后再通过日复一日的艰苦学习,努力实践,达到灵活掌握,运用自如的水平。Microsoft SQL Server 今年来虽然在国内的互联网企业运用日渐式微,但是从全球来看它依然是稳坐前三的关系型数据库产品,同时随着Azure的日渐成长,目前在海外的声势日渐庞大,掌握SQL Server能伴你一生无忧。### **资质&证书**微...

集简云 x 广东硕康丨实现SQL Server快速集成第三方系统,助力企业内部减负增效

硕康近几年一直在高速发展,为了对业务与财务管理更加精细,公司内部使用金蝶K3作为财务ERP系统,并对财务系统进行了本地化部署,实现财务的某些数据自动推送到SQL Server数据库中存储;另外使用简道云进行一些业务流创... 传统的线下表格录入形式,已经无法满足当下企业数字化转型的需求。**#### 系统之间不互通,想要将SQL Server数据库与简道云的数据实现实时同步不是易事,订单、库存等单据加起来每天1000左右的单据量单纯依赖人工...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

SQLServer:在缺失月份的表格中插入默认值 -优选内容

SQLServer CDC
WITH ( 'connector' = 'sqlserver-cdc', 'hostname' = 'mssql****85.rds-mssql.ivolces.com', 'port' = '1433', 'username' = 'doc_user', 'password' = 'Pwd***5!', 'database-name' = 'doc_autotest', 'table-name' = 'dbo.orders' ); WITH 参数参数 是否必选 默认值 数据类型 描述 connector 是 (none) String 指定使用的连接器,此处是 sqlserver-cdc 连接器。 hostname 是 (none) String...
云数据库 SQL Server 版-火山引擎
云数据库 SQL Server 版拥有正版授权,能够高度兼容微软生态下的各类应用,并提供实例管理、备份恢复、日志管理、监控告警、数据迁移等全套解决方案,帮助企业更多聚焦于自己的核心业务。
【模板推荐】玩转SQL Server数据库自动同步
用户可以在“模板中心”搜索应用名称,选择适合自己的场景,直接使用。本期分享 **SQL Server**自动化工作流程。![picture.image](https://p6-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/6fa94d6... 免费入驻集简云应用中心,让您的产品拥有与800+款软件连接的能力![点击添加负责人信息](https://work.weixin.qq.com/ca/cawcde884ca3f5cfea),帮助您快速上架![![picture.image](https://p6-volc-c...
【模板推荐】玩转SQL Server数据库自动同步
[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/baec24fd122d457697fd1f68b48721fa~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1716135627&x-signature=FQomYph%2FPlBBgxmw1MyfXat1dtM%3D)集简云平台内置大量自动化流程模板,用户可以在“模板中心”搜索应用名称,选择适合自己的场景,直接使用。本期分享 **SQL Server**自动化工作流程。![picture.image](https:...

SQLServer:在缺失月份的表格中插入默认值 -相关内容

Microsoft SQL Server 从零开始成为高手,全攻略

如何才能成为某一个领域的高手?你需要有一个明确的目标(知道要学什么);同时还要为这个目标找到一条明确的道路(知道怎么学)。最后再通过日复一日的艰苦学习,努力实践,达到灵活掌握,运用自如的水平。Microsoft SQL Server 今年来虽然在国内的互联网企业运用日渐式微,但是从全球来看它依然是稳坐前三的关系型数据库产品,同时随着Azure的日渐成长,目前在海外的声势日渐庞大,掌握SQL Server能伴你一生无忧。### **资质&证书**微...

集简云 x 广东硕康丨实现SQL Server快速集成第三方系统,助力企业内部减负增效

硕康近几年一直在高速发展,为了对业务与财务管理更加精细,公司内部使用金蝶K3作为财务ERP系统,并对财务系统进行了本地化部署,实现财务的某些数据自动推送到SQL Server数据库中存储;另外使用简道云进行一些业务流创... 传统的线下表格录入形式,已经无法满足当下企业数字化转型的需求。**#### 系统之间不互通,想要将SQL Server数据库与简道云的数据实现实时同步不是易事,订单、库存等单据加起来每天1000左右的单据量单纯依赖人工...

配置 SQLServer 数据源

需要将集成资源组所在 VPC 中的 IPv4 CIDR 地址添加SQLServer 访问白名单中:确认集成资源组所在的 VPC: 查看 VPC 的 IPv4 CIDR 地址:注意 若考虑安全因素,减少 IP CIDR 的访问范围,您至少需要将集成资源组绑定的... 仅支持中文,英文,数字,“_”,100个字符以内。 参数配置 主机名或IP地址 SQLServer 数据库的主机名称或者 IP 地址。 端口 主机的端口号。 数据库名 输入已创建的 SQLServer 数据库名称。 用户名 有权限访问...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

干货 | 在字节跳动,一个更好的企业级SparkSQL Server这么做

SparkSQL可直接输入SQL对数据进行ETL等工作的处理,极大提升了易用度。但是相比Hive等引擎来说,由于SparkSQL缺乏一个类似Hive Server2的SQL服务器,导致SparkSQL在易用性上比不上Hive。很多时候,SparkSQL只能将自身... 在代码中只需要通过如下的代码方式:```Class.forName("com.mysql.cj.jdbc.Driver");Connection connection= DriverManager.getConnection(DB_URL,USER,PASS);//操作connection.close();```第一,初始化驱...

什么是云数据库 SQL Server

产品定义云数据库 SQL Server 版是火山引擎基于世界一流的商用型数据库产品 Microsoft SQL Server 打造的一种稳定、可靠、可弹性伸缩的在线数据库服务。SQL Server 实例采用云原生方式部署,通过结合极速型 SSD 云盘,提供了高性能读写能力。云数据库 SQL Server 版能够完全兼容微软生态下的各类应用,并提供实例管理、备份恢复、日志管理、监控告警、数据迁移等全套解决方案,帮助企业简化繁杂的数据库管理和运维任务,使企业有更多的...

干货 | 在字节跳动,一个更好的企业级SparkSQL Server这么做

SparkSQL可直接输入SQL对数据进行ETL等工作的处理,极大提升了易用度。但是相比Hive等引擎来说,由于SparkSQL缺乏一个类似Hive Server2的SQL服务器,导致SparkSQL在易用性上比不上Hive。很多时候,SparkSQL只能将自... Class.forName("com.mysql.cj.jdbc.Driver"); Connection connection= DriverManager.getConnection(DB_URL,USER,PASS); //操作 connection.close(); ```第一,初始化...

SQL自定义查询(SaaS)

任何SQL都建议指定事件发生时间,否则根据event_time进行推导。 event_time 事件发生时间戳,10位。 当且仅当使用event_time作为约束条件时,会自动推导event_date;因此不建议使用time和server_time进行时间条件的约... 1.5 常用函数近似分位数函数 quantile 与 近似中位数 median quantile(level)(expr)参数 Level —— 分位数层次。可选参数,level的推荐取值范围为[0.01, 0.99],默认值level=0.5,即为计算中位数。 expr —— 表达式...

在字节跳动,一个更好的企业级 SparkSQL Server 这么做

SparkSQL可直接输入SQL对数据进行ETL等工作的处理,极大提升了易用度。但是相比Hive等引擎来说,由于SparkSQL缺乏一个类似Hive Server2的SQL服务器,导致SparkSQL在易用性上比不上Hive。很多时候,SparkSQL只能将自身... 在代码中只需要通过如下的代码方式:```Class.forName("com.mysql.cj.jdbc.Driver");Connection connection= DriverManager.getConnection(DB_URL,USER,PASS);//操作connection.close();```第一,初始化驱动...

SQL Server数据连接

1. 产品概述 支持SQL Sever数据连接。 说明 在连接数据之前,请收集以下信息: 数据库所在服务器的 IP 地址和端口号; 数据库的名称; 数据库的用户名和密码。 2. 使用限制 用户需具备 项目编辑 或 权限-按内容管理-模块-数据连接-新建连接 权限,才能新建数据连接。 3. 操作步骤 点击 数据融合>数据连接 。 点击左上角 新建数据连接,在跳转的页面选择SQL Sever。 填写所需的基本信息,并进行 测试连接 。 连接成功后点击 保存 即可。

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询